Two cows visited a veterinary clinic in the eastern province of Kars, and stated their protest by mooing when nobody showed up to help, as the clinic was closed.

An eyewitness recorded the cows' protest outside the clinic, and the footage became highly popular on social media on Oct. 6.

The onlooker is heard telling the cows that the veterinary, İbrahim, wasn't in the clinic, and asking whether the cattle didn't believe him when they continue mooing.
